The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) is responsible for safely completing patient medication pass, completing Q-15 minute rounds and vital signs, assisting with treatment plans, medication reconciliation at discharge, weekly MAR change-over, 24 hour chart checks, and other assigned documentation.
Additionally, the LPN may be required to conduct daily nursing groups on the units and other tasks as assigned by nursing leadership.
QualificationsGraduate of an accredited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) program. Prefer one (1) year experience as an LPN. Prefer six (6) months in psychiatry nursing. Knowledge of current nursing procedures, the nursing process, medications and their correct administration.
